‘GST impact on inflation to be less than 20 bps’

-

The implementa­tion of Goods and Services Tax (GST) is likely to be fiscally neutral and its impact on inflation is expected to be less than 20 basis points, according to a Nomura report

STEADY PROGRESS

The GST council is making steady progress and GST is likely to be implemente­d in the July-september quarter this year

EFFECT ON GROWTH

Though the impact of GST is likely to be minimal, growth numbers are expected to get affected in the run up to its implementa­tion

FINANCIALL­Y NEUTRAL

In the near term the GST will be fiscally neutral and

resulting inflation impact to be minimal at less than 20 bps, says the report

PRODUCTIVI­TY BOOST

Over time, the eliminatio­n of cascading taxes and its simplified tax structure will boost productivi­ty, lower costs, aid in the formalisat­ion of the economy and result in large revenue benefits for the government

THE STATUS

■ The GST council has formally approved all five of Bills related to the implementa­tion of the GST: central GST, state GST, integrated GST, Union Territorie­s GST (UTGST) and the compensati­on law

■ Four of the five bills — CGST, IGST, UTGST and the compensati­on law — have got the Cabinet nod and are set to tabled in the Lok Sabha in the ongoing Budget session
